fix(tradein/scraper): drain detached run-children on SIGTERM, not just coordinator (#1182 Phase 2)
Pre-push review: _await_scheduler ждал только scheduler_loop COORDINATOR, но вся scrape-работа крутится в detached asyncio.create_task детях (каждый trigger_* делал `task = create_task(_run())` без join). На SIGTERM coordinator выходил из while True и завершался → asyncio.run() teardown хард-кансельил ещё бегущих детей mid-await = ровно #1182 failure mode. Кооперативный checkpoint спасал ребёнка лишь когда его residual-время случайно перекрывало drain — вероятностно, не гарантированно. Fix — coordinator теперь дренажит детей перед выходом: - _spawn_tracked(coro): централизованный detached-spawn, кладёт задачу в module-level registry _inflight_tasks (strong-ref = RUF006 keep-alive) + done-callback ретривит exception и убирает из set'а. Заменил 26 одинаковых `task = create_task(_run()); task.add_done_callback(...)` сайтов. - _drain_inflight(): один asyncio.wait по живым детям с бюджетом _CHILD_DRAIN_TIMEOUT_S=80s (< scheduler_main 100s < docker grace 120s). Кооперативные дети (avito_detail_backfill, rosreestr-executor) дочекивают карточку/батч + mark_done и резолвятся; некооперативные упираются в timeout и падают на внешний hard-cancel. - scheduler_loop по выходу из tick-loop (только по SIGTERM) зовёт await _drain_inflight(). NB: raw asyncio.all_tasks()-minus-self здесь НЕЛЬЗЯ — в нашей топологии он захватывает _run parent-task (блокирован на wait_for(coordinator)) и shutdown_waiter → циклическое ожидание coordinator↔_run, всегда упирающееся в timeout. Точный registry это исключает. Tests: tests/test_scheduler.py — detached cooperative child drained-not-cancelled, non-cooperative child timeout→left for hard-cancel, no-op без детей, scheduler_loop→drain wiring. Обновил 3 source-inspection теста под новый _spawn_tracked паттерн.
